While your body adapts, a few simple habits can make a big difference: Eat smaller, more frequent meals to avoid overloading your stomach Limit spicy, fatty, or fried foods, which can worsen symptoms Cut back on acidic drinks and foods like coffee, fizzy drinks, and alcohol Stay hydrated by sipping water regularly throughout the day Try fresh ginger, either in tea or added to meals, as it can help soothe nausea If nausea is not improving or is affecting your day to day life, our clinicians are here to support you with personalised advice and treatment options if needed
